Appeals Panel Finds Unclean Hands Doctrine Bars Woman From Estate Benefit

(June 3, 2019, 11:26 AM EDT) -- ANNAPOLIS, Md. — The doctrine of unclean hands bars a deceased man’s third wife from obtaining a share of his estate because their marriage was procured as a result of undue influence, the Maryland Court of Special Appeals ruled May 29 in affirming a lower court panel’s decision (In the Matter of Robert H. Watkins Jr., No. 2171, September Term, 2017, Md. Spec. App., 2019 Md.  LEXIS 269)....
